I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Savannah Nicole
Beatty
November 13, 2000 – September 21, 2025
Our precious and beautiful daughter, sister, aunt, granddaughter, dog-mom and friend Savannah Nicole Beatty, age 24 soared to be with her creator Jesus Christ on September 21, 2025 at 8:27pm at OSU Medical Center in Columbus, Ohio. Savannah was surrounded by her loving family. Savannah's beauty radiated in showing kindness, thoughtfulness, generosity, genuineness, and compassion towards others in times of need. Savannah was a very blunt young lady, radiating boldness throughout her personality. Savannah was always just one call away. Savannah's love for animals was unmatched as she would rescue any creature when needed. Savannah's fur-baby "Harley" was her 8-year-old dog-child, now trusted in the care of her mother, "gam-gams." Savannah worked as an assistant manager for Ace Hardware, later as a caseworker, and was involved in sales through electric energy services. Savannah's skills in diagnosing vehicle repairs continuously awed her family. Any car issues, "Call Savannah." Savannah was also a talented chef in the kitchen as she always spoke about a new recipe she wanted to try. Savannah's aspiration in creating a beauty-line will be carried out by her oldest sister. Her talent for making others feel beautiful both inside and out was something Savannah was easily able to do. There are so many things to say about Savannah Nicole, yet there are also not enough words to describe the love, the humor, and the joy in just being in her presence. You would have had to intimately know her to fully gain insight into the wonderful human God created her to be. The ultimate essence of Savannah's life is that she dedicated her entire being to the Lord Jesus Christ and claimed him as her personal savior. As her mother writing this obituary for her family, nothing else matters other than the reunion back in Christ's arms. Scripture from Colossians 3:2 states, "set your mind on things above and not on earthly things." Savannah left us to meet her baby sister April Beatty in heaven, along with joining her maternal grandfather Jimmie Washburn and "grandma/grandpa Washburn" and paternal grandparents Clifford and Joanne Beatty, and Uncle Tracey Beatty. Savannah left behind her mother, Mindy (Washburn) Willis and father David M. Beatty, Siblings include an older sister, Shyann Matthews and younger sister, Macy Willis. Her older brothers, Cody Beatty and his spouse Amanda; Jason Beatty and his spouse Annie, and Shawn Beatty and his spouse Anna. Her nieces and nephews Addilynn, Carson, Blake, Mackenzie, Emma, and Isabella. Her maternal grandparents include Norman May (papa), and Tom and Ann Hoskinson.
Private services will be held at the Summers Funeral Home with Pastor Jami Massie officiating.
